Senior Ui Developer Resume
Chicago, IL
SUMMARY:
- 13 plus years of experience in web development using HTML4/5, CSS2/3, Bootstrap, JavaScript, JQuery, XML, AJAX. Server site scripting with PHP, ASP, ASP.NET and database engines MySQL, SQL Server. Desktop development using Visual Basic, C++, C#.
- Experience with Web Full Stack development through frameworks such as Code Igniter etc.
- 2 Years of experience using Angular JS 1 & 2 in front end development and as an integrator with Umbraco CMS.
- Over 5+ years promoting the use of Methodologies for software development such as SCRUM, UML, SDM, UX, UI.
- Experience working in an agile environment, focused on test - driven development with an emphasis on delivering working software for stakeholders.
- 2 years of experience using React JS for web development.
- Over 5+ years of experience with CMS for solutions with Word press, Shopify, Drupal.
- 2 years of experience working with node.js and angular.js
- Experience with front-end development for responsive web sites, native IOS and Android App development, hybrid IOS and Android App development with frameworks such as Cordoba and Ionic.
- Experience with large-scale distributed systems and web oriental architectures.
- Experience with project management and documentation through Time tables, RFP, bug tracking evidence and recollection, use cases, user manual, installation instructions (if required), budget planning and justification, commented code.
- Strong experience in Technical lead activities and team building skills.
- Strong experience with Project Management Tools & Software Management such as Primavera EE, Primavision.
- Experience with Facebook API, Twitter API, YouTube API and Google Maps API for websites, IOS and Android.
- Experience with Proactive research of new technologies such as Virtual Reality and Augmented Reality.
- Experience in Version Control management with GitHub.
- Strong experience in 360º digital marketing strategies including Google Analytics, SEO, SEM, SMM, e-mail marketing and e-commerce.
- Hands on experience in modern server side programming such as NodeJS.
- Strong business analytical skills for Budget estimation, analysis, design, maintenance, testing and user requirements.
- Experience with unit testing using Jest and Tape for UI, React and Node components.
TECHNICAL SKILLS:
Programming: Front-End HTML5, React JS, Angular JS, Node JS, CSS3, XML, Ajax, JSON, JQuery, Bootstrap, Back-End PHP, ASP.NET, GitHub, Desktop Visual Basic, C++, C#, Unity, Mobile Native IOS with Xcode and Android with Android Studio, Databases MySQL, SQL Server, CMS Word Press, Drupal, E-Commerce Shopify, Banwire, Conekta
Social Marketing: SEO Google Analytics, AdWords, implementation in websites, SEM Google AdWords Facebook Ads, SMM Facebook, Twitter, LinkedIn campaigns, Social Media insights, Social Media Facebook, Twitter, YouTube, Instagram
Design: Software Photoshop, Illustrator
PROFESSIONAL EXPERIENCE:
Confidential, Chicago, IL
Senior UI Developer
Responsibilities:
- UI development using React with Redux for complex banking applications
- Integration of React UI with Node backend
- Creation of mock server data and responses for testing before pushing to QA
- Unit testing using Jest and Tape Frameworks
- Working in an agile environment using SCRUM as main methodology
Confidential, Chicago, IL
Senior UI Developer
Responsibilities:
- Work with data science team and transform the requirements into automation software pipeline.
- Create flow charts, entity relationship diagrams and technical documentation for each project.
- Extract and analyse metrics for measuring all the web and mobile applications performance.
- Evaluate third party solutions for integration into existing or future projects.
- Translate client requirements into a technical requirement finding the best solution and tools for solving it
- Define data and project structure to best fit into the Marketing department needs to build high level performance reports.
- Define data schemes for web projects for optimal communication with most common browsers.
- Design and develop client side APIs and libraries to interface with server, cloud storage and compute platforms.
- Design and present new visual proposals for optimum performance of web and mobile apps while following the UI/UX rules.
- Design and implement enhancements for Data Bases, web apps and mobile apps.
- Develop web based UI and back end to facilitate data ingestion, storage, annotation and visualization.
- Evaluate and integrate third party tools.
- Support, maintain and help document software functionality.
- Develop a new front-end web application, consuming multiple back-end services.
- Implement third party solutions into existing solutions.
- Automation of data insertion into Salesforce from landing pages and web apps.
- Integrate social media APIs for marketing purposes.
- Data migration from old content managers to more recent technologies.
- Implement web marketing’s best practices in web projects such as SEO and SEM.
Tools: Git, Azure, Visual Studio Code, Gulp and Node
Confidential
Senior Front-End Developer
Responsibilities:
- Front end development using HTML5, JQuery, AJAX, CSS3, Angular JS, Bootstrap.
- Back end development with Word Press, XML, PHP, .NET
- Database design and integration with MySQL and SQL server.
- Running tests on websites before and after deployment.
- Mobile apps development for IOS and Android.
- Project documentation according to SCRUM methodology
- SCRUM Master with agile methodology with team leads of development.
- Full cycle methodology (SCRUM) implementation for all developments.
- Research for new business opportunities with new technologies such as Augmented Reality and Virtual Reality.
- Research on new frameworks to reduce development time such as Code igniter, Shopify and Angular JS.
- Data extraction and data mining for BI used as statistics for Business Owners for decision making.
- SEO implementation and analysis for websites.
Confidential
Application Development Services for e-Commerce
Responsibilities:
- Daily maintenance for all B2C websites in ASP and SQL server (upload new content, bug resolution)
- Strategy generation for new or on-going projects working along the business assigned responsible.
- Code standardization according to the established paradigms.
- Project releasing with documentation according to methodology (SDM): RFP, Use Cases, Key Indicators, Bug Tracking, Budget Justification, and User Manual.
- Front end and Back end development for web projects and internal software using ASP.NET/C#/C++
Confidential
Web Developer
Responsibilities:
- Define, analyse, developed websites and desktop Software
- Generated mock-ups and wireframes.
- Requested management for handling troubleshooting on websites.
- Front end development using Flash, FLEX, HTML, CSS, JavaScript, AJAX
- Back end development with ASP and PHP with MySQL integration
- Regular meetings with clients for time table and project revision.
- Translation of clients’ requests into technical language for development.